    Healthy Keto: A Balanced Path to Sustainable Weight Management

    News TeamBy News Team23/01/2025No Comments6 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    The ketogenic diet, or keto, is a high-fat, low-carbohydrate eating plan designed to shift the body’s metabolism from relying on glucose (sugar) to using fat as its primary energy source. Ketosis kicks in when the liver shifts gears, turning fat into ketones that give your brain and body the fuel they need to function at their best.

    A standard keto diet typically consists of:

    • 70-75% healthy fats
    • 20-25% protein
    • 5-10% carbohydrates

    By drastically reducing carbohydrate intake, the body transitions to burning fat for energy, leading to various health benefits, including weight loss. However, the key to success lies in following a Healthy Keto approach, which focuses on consuming whole, nutrient-dense foods rather than relying on processed “keto-friendly” products.

    The Benefits of a Healthy Keto Approach to Weight Management

    The Healthy Keto diet offers several advantages for effective and sustainable weight management:

    1. Increased Satiety and Reduced Hunger: Healthy fats are naturally more filling than carbohydrates, leading to reduced cravings and spontaneous calorie reduction without feeling deprived. Fats have a surprising benefit – they can actually tame our hunger by supporting hormones like ghrelin and leptin.
    2. Enhanced Fat Burning: Burning fat for fuel becomes a highly efficient process once your body hits ketosis, resulting in a steady and consistent drop in weight.
    3. Stable Energy Levels: Unlike high-carb diets that cause blood sugar spikes and crashes, keto provides a consistent energy supply, keeping you energized throughout the day.
    4. Improved Mental Focus and Clarity: Many individuals experience sharper mental clarity on keto due to the brain’s preference for ketones as a clean, efficient fuel source.

    The Importance of Nutrient-Dense Foods in a Healthy Keto Diet

    Not all fats are created equal. A Healthy Keto approach emphasizes quality fats and nutrient-dense foods for optimal health and weight management:

    Healthy Fats:

    • Avocados: Rich in monounsaturated fats and fiber
    • Olive Oil: High in heart-healthy fats and antioxidants
    • Nuts and Seeds: Provide healthy fats, fiber, and minerals
    • Fatty Fish: Salmon and mackerel are rich in omega-3 fatty acids

    Low-Carb Vegetables: Non-starchy vegetables like spinach, broccoli, and zucchini are packed with vitamins, minerals, and fiber.

    According to a study published in the British Journal of Nutrition, prioritizing nutrient-dense foods provides your body with essential nutrients, promoting overall health and aiding in weight management. Incorporating a variety of nutrient-rich foods supports better digestion and reduces the risk of chronic diseases.

    Addressing Common Misconceptions About Keto and Weight Management

    Despite its growing popularity, several myths surround the keto diet:

    Myth 1: Keto Encourages Unhealthy Eating Many assume keto promotes eating excessive amounts of bacon, cheese, and butter. However, Healthy Keto emphasizes whole foods and healthy fats, not processed, high-saturated-fat foods.

    Myth 2: Keto Causes Muscle Loss When combined with adequate protein intake and resistance training, keto preserves lean muscle while promoting fat loss.

    Myth 3: Weight Gain Happens After Stopping Keto Weight regain is common with any diet when old habits return. By sticking to the Healthy Keto method, you’ll be programming yourself with habits that naturally promote weight stability, no extreme willpower required.

    Practical Tips for Incorporating Healthy Keto into Your Lifestyle

    Transitioning to a Healthy Keto lifestyle doesn’t have to be overwhelming. These strategies can help you adopt and maintain this approach effectively:

    1. Meal Planning: Plan meals ahead to avoid unhealthy choices. Prepare keto-friendly snacks like nuts, cheese crisps, or avocado slices to stay on track.
    2. Focus on Whole Foods: Base meals around healthy fats, quality proteins, and low-carb vegetables. Avoid processed “keto” snacks that contain hidden sugars or unhealthy oils.
    3. Stay Hydrated and Balance Electrolytes: Drink plenty of water and replenish electrolytes (sodium, potassium, magnesium) to prevent dehydration and fatigue.
    4. Find Support: Join keto communities or connect with others on the same journey for motivation, accountability, and recipe ideas.
